I graduated from Lubbock High School with an IB degree. I earned my bachelor's degree in Neuroscience from Johns Hopkins University.. After graduating, I became certified to teach high school math by the College of Education at Texas Tech. I then taught high school math - Algebra, Geometry, PreCalculus and Calculus for four years. I am currently certified to teach high school math (8-12) in the state of Texas. My favorite subjects to tutor are Algebra and Geometry. I volunteered as a peer tutor when I was in college and tutored students in PreCalculus and Introductory Calculus.

I know that math is a challenging subject, and may seem difficult to master. However, I believe that with the right guidance, it is possible for everyone to understand math and become successful at it.
